I just bought some Zipp 404 clincher's, and the valve stem they came with has a hole in the end, my LBS put some tires on for me and said if I need to put air in the tires the pump would go over this valve stem. How do you take air out of this type of stem? I am wondering how this works?

If I understand you correctly, you have the cheapo valve extenders screwed onto the valve stems. To deflate the tire, use something skinny to insert through the hole and depress the valve stem. A small allen wrench will usually work.
